  1. Given the narrative's satirical spin, what practical lessons can be derived from the "Vitan Method" regarding balancing minimalism and innovation in product development?
Despite its satirical presentation, the "Vitan Method" highlights valuable insights into balancing the principles of minimalism and innovation within product development. One can find lessons in prioritizing simplicity and clarity when launching new features, ensuring that each increment is purposeful and addresses core user needs. However, minimalism should not come at the expense of viability; there must be a balance between simplicity and functionality to secure meaningful engagement. In practice, startups should aim for lean, adaptable processes that permit quick pivots while maintaining a firm grasp on quality and user experience. Embracing a minimalistic approach can reduce development time and resource allocation, but always with the foresight to scale and expand functionalities as market demands evolve.
